网站优化

网站优化

Products

当前位置:首页 > 网站优化 >

阅读printjs详解,能快速掌握打印网页的实用技巧吗?

GG网络技术分享 2025-11-12 22:14 2


根据您给的文档内容,

一、安装与基本用

先说说您需要通过npm安装print-js库:

bash npm install print-js

然后您Neng在HTML文件中引入print-js库,并用它来打印内容:

这里printable属性指定了要打印的内容,type属性指定了内容类型,css属性指定了自定义样式表路径,lang属性用于设置许多语言支持。

二、 高大级用

自定义打印样式

在打印前,您Neng修改页面样式来自定义打印样式:

javascript var originalBodyStyles = window.getComputedStyle.cssText; var originalPageStyles = document.getElementById.style.cssText;

document.body.style.width = '21cm'; document.body.style.height = '.7cm'; document.getElementById.style.width = '%'; document.getElementById.style.padding = '2cm';

printJS({ printable: '打印内容', type: 'html', css: '/path/to/style.css' });

document.body.style.cssText = originalBodyStyles; document.getElementById.style.cssText = originalPageStyles;

打印表格

print-js打印表格非常轻巧松:

javascript import printJS from 'print-js';

printJS;

其中,打印内容Neng是HTML元素、HTML字符串或URL地址。

三、 应用场景

print-jsNeng应用于许多种场景,比方说:

  • 打印当前页面或指定页面。
  • 将页面内容转换成PDF格式并下载。
  • 打印图片并转换为PDF格式。

  • 打印当前页面:

javascript printJS;

  • 打印指定HTML元素:
  • 打印HTML字符串:
  • 打印URL地址:

print-js是一个功Neng有力巨大的JavaScript库,Neng帮您轻巧松地将网页内容打印为PDF、图片或纯文本格式。通过上述示例,您得Neng够了解怎么用print-js进行网页打印。希望本文对您有所帮!

标签:

提交需求或反馈

Demand feedback